Output e2a268f1fd63d6c89568f66c8d5931f1e6fef546b6d04552f91dc6fad0174340:0

value
44238700
script pubkey
OP_0 OP_PUSHBYTES_20 8fa362b99d5b54764debd89ae554bb6af45ea08b
address
bc1q373k9wvatd28vn0tmzdw249mdt69agyt48pc9l
transaction
e2a268f1fd63d6c89568f66c8d5931f1e6fef546b6d04552f91dc6fad0174340
spent
true